Job Skills / Requirements
Starting wages: $12.14 hourly. Killian and West End Head Start locations. Will be responsible for implementing instructional experiences for children in a safe and healthy environment in a variety of classrooms and settings. Working 7.5 hours per day, 37.5 hours per week, 260 days per year.
A high school diploma or GED is required. Child Development Associate credential must be obtained within one year of employment.

Deadline to apply: February 9, 2025
Benefits: Medical Insurance, Life Insurance, Dental Insurance, Vision Insurance, Paid Vacation, Paid Sick Days, Paid Holidays, Pension/Retirement
Screening Requirements: Criminal Background Check, Physical Exam, TB test
